Quick tips for your Ericeira breakfast and brunch:

  • On the weekends, especially during the summer high season, it’s worth making a reservation so you don’t have to wait for your table.
  • Nearly every cafe in Ericeira has great espresso. When you order a “coffee”, you’re ordering a small espresso. 
  • For cappuccinos and lattes, my favorite places are Balagan, Dear Rose, and Sunset Bamboo.  
  • For a quick and easy breakfast, grab a pastry or bread at one of Ericeira’s many bakeries and enjoy by the beach (Pão da Vila, Terço do Meio, and Ericeirapão are easy options in the center of town)

Balagan

The Balagan Mezze plate for one person has hummus, falafel, and fresh vegetables
A refreshing cocktail from Balagan Ericeira, one of the best restaurants and places to grab a drink

Balagan Ericeira:

  • The cafe (downstairs) open every day from 9:00 am until 6:00 pm
  • The restaurant (upstairs) open Wednesday to Monday from 12:30 pm to 11:00 pm
  • Address: Praia do Sul, Ericeira
  • Find on their website and Instagram

Balagan is a must when visiting Ericeira. It’s located on the beach at Praia do Sul so you’ll have incredible views while you eat, plus they make great coffees, juices, and Mediterranean and Middle Eastern-inspired dishes.

Downstairs, there’s a walk-up cafe where you can order from a smaller menu, and the food is always amazing. You can try breakfast bowls, croissants, cinnamon rolls, and wraps. They have indoor and outdoor seating, WiFi, and a special table for coworking if you’d like to get some work done. 

Upstairs, there’s a more formal dining area where you can reserve tables for lunch and dinner. This is best if you want a sit-down brunch or if you want a premium table with an even better sea view. I recommend getting the Grand Balagan Mezze plate if you want to try a little of everything – it comes with pita, hummus, falafel, baba ghanoush, and veggies that are so good you’ll want to lick the plate. 

If you come for brunch drinks or later in the evening, Balagan also makes a mean cocktail. I love their Balagan spritz (dangerous!) and gin basil (even more dangerous!) and of course, the panorama sea view doesn’t hurt. 

Terço do Meio Sourdough Bakery & Café

Terço do Meio Sourdough Bakery & Café Ericeira:

  • Wednesday – Saturday: 8:30 am – 4:30 pm 
  • Sunday: 8:30 am – 2:30 pm
  • Closed Monday and Tuesday
  • Address: Praça dos Navegantes loja 16, 2655-320 Ericeira
  • Find on Instagram

If you’re looking for a quick breakfast, as well as the best bread and treats in town, swing by Terco do Meio sourdough bakery. They have the best cinnamon roll in Ericeira (trust me, I’ve tried all of them!), the owners are wonderful, and you can try a small seasonal menu of incredible sandwiches and bakery delights made fresh in-house. 

Make sure to get anything made with their focaccia bread, and grab a cookie for later. They also have vegan bakery options available. The temptation to come here every single day and eat everything on the menu is very hard to resist. 

Dear Rose Cafe

Dear Rose Ericeira:

  • Open Wednesday to Sunday
  • Closed Monday and Tuesday
  • Hours: 10:30 am until 4:30 pm
  • Address: Rua Santo Antonio 12A, Ericeira
  • Find on Instagram 

Dear Rose is a small cafe in town near Praia dos Pescadores and they’re known for having excellent coffee. Their baked goods are also delicious (I love the lemon cake and carrot cake) and they have vegan options. There’s a breakfast and brunch menu with bagels, shakshuka, acai bowls, and savory bowls, as well as seasonal specials like curry and creative toasts. 

Because Dear Rose has just a few tables, it can sometimes be a challenge to get a seat on the weekends, but even if it’s full you can still grab something for takeaway and eat it on the benches near the beach. I love stopping in Dear Rose for a coffee to go while I’m walking through town or on my way to Pescadores. 

Sunset Bamboo

Sunset Bamboo Ericeira:

  • Closed on Wednesday 
  • Hours: 10:00 am until 5:00 pm
  • Address: Travessa do Jogo da Bola 
  • Find on Instagram

Another great coffee spot located right off the main square is Sunset Bamboo. They have nice coffees and juices, and to eat I love their Yogy Acai bowl (a combination of yogurt and Acai), their burritos, and their bagels. They also have tasty tostas that you can get in full-size or half-size. 

Sunset Bamboo has nice outdoor seating with umbrellas if the weather is good, and they also have a comfy inside space with lots of tables and a couch area. You can cowork here on less crowded days, and this is another spot where I like to grab a takeaway coffee (good cappuccinos) while going out on adventures for the day. They don’t take cards, so make sure to grab cash at one of the ATMs in the town square before you visit.

Ericeirapão

Ericeirapão Breakfast Ericeira:

  • Open every day from 7:00 am – 8:00 pm 
  • Address: R. Dr. Eduardo Burnay 25, 2655-370 Ericeira
  • Find on Google Maps

Ericeirapão is a local bakery and breakfast spot with plenty of indoor and outdoor seating. In addition to picking up your bread for the day, they also have bagels, yogurt bowls, pancakes, egg dishes, and big (giant!) toasts. 

I love stopping in for a bagel and fresh green juice, plus the outdoor seating area is perfect for people-watching on one of the main pedestrian roads of Ericeira. To order here, enter the restaurant and take a number from the machine at the door. Once your number is displayed on the electronic screen, you can order for dine-in or takeaway. 

Pão da Vila

An omelette with a side of fries and salad from Pão da Vila

Pão da Vila Ericeira:

An Ericeira classic! Pão da Vila is a bakery, pastry shop, and restaurant that’s open all day, every day. They have a special brunch set menu and they also serve toasts, hamburgers, wraps, omelets, salads, savory bowls, and pizzas. Pão da Vila is one of the best values for money in Ericeira and the portions are quite large and filling, so this is a good option if you’re extra hungry. Plus it’s right in the town square, or jogo da bola, and you can grab an amazing pastry for dessert if you still have room. 

Here, I like their veggie wrap, salads, and soup of the day. I’ve also tried their omelets and they’re massive and come with a side of fries and salad, perfect if you’re hungry after a big surf or a day of exploring.
